Good progress so far. You do need 3 open revolvers to drive Fico and typically there is a bump for each of them opening but its up to you.
I finally made a spreadsheet listing all my debt, who owns it, monthly bills and income, and the plan of action I want to take with each one. Prioritizing which to pay down first and how much money I can actually give to CAs and OCs.
It is a really really hard thing to see that you have almost 40k in debt... so shocking.
I am sticking to my budget super strictly, droped all my unnecesary expenses. My only luxury expense (aside from my astounding car payment) is my climbing gym membership. 50 bucks a month and I am there almost every day. I need the outlet; definitely worth it.
Putting it all out on one paper made it so much more real than my stack of collection bills and letters from the IRS.
I highly suggest this to anyone trying to devise a plan. No more random sheets of paper (that i eventually lose) listing all the debts.
